Newbury Racecourse is a Racecourse in the Civil Parish of Greenham , adjoining the Town of Newbury in Berkshire , England . It has courses for flat races and over jumps. It hosts one of Great Britain's 31 Group 1 flat races, the Lockinge Stakes . It also acts as a venue for conferences, as well as major LAN Parties . The racecourse held its first race meeting on 26 / 27 September 1905 and moved to its current location, in the Greenham area on the south-east side of Newbury, in 1910. The racecourse boasts a Runway for light Aircraft in the centre of the course and has its own railway station, Newbury Racecourse Railway Station , which sees heavy traffic and additional trains on race days.
